Digital Storm Javelin, Lance, Krypton and Behemoth

Digital Storm Gaming Notebooks

Digital Storm today unveiled four gaming notebooks with the new NVIDIA GTX 800M series of graphics cards – the 15.6 inch Javelin and Lance and the 17.3 inch Krypton and Behemoth.  The new generation of graphics cards offers improved performance and advanced technology like Battery Boost, to maximize battery life during gaming, and ShadowPlay for recording gameplay streams.

Starting at just $1,196 the custom built Javelin gaming notebook delvers stellar gaming performance and a high-definition multimedia experience. The Javelin’s 1080P display allows gamers to experience every inch of the battlefield in incredible detail.

The powerful Lance utilizes a high performance notebook cooling system that compartmentalizes critical hardware to keep the notebook frosty during even the most intense sessions.  The notebook also comes equipped with Sound Blaster’s X-Fi MB3 platform and two precision balanced Onkyo speakers with a built in subwoofer to deliver dynamic, immersive audio.

With room for up to three storage drives and fully upgradable components (graphics card, processor, and memory), timeworn technology can no longer vanquish a gamer’s long-term plans. The 17.3 inch Krypton is a mobile war machine with an unquenchable thirst for upgrades, allowing its owner to remain a dominant force for years to come.

The unstoppable 17.3-inch Behemoth features dual SLI GTX 880M graphics cards to unleash jaw-dropping performance with even the most demanding games.  Digital Storm’s multi-zone customizable LED backlit keyboard will not only turn heads, but also keeps gamers in control in the heat of battle.

“We’ve wanted to refresh our notebook line for a while and the NVIDIA GTX 800M series launch provided the perfect timing,” said Rajeev Kuruppu, Digital Storm’s Director of Product Development.  “The cards’ ability to deliver gaming performance comparable to a desktop system allow our notebooks to dominate anywhere.”

Price and Availability
Digital Storm’s gaming notebooks are available exclusively at http://www.digitalstormonline.com/gaming-laptops.asp starting at $1,196.
